Demande de conseils pour mise en place de réplication
1 réponse
Xavier
Bonjour,
Nous avons actuellement 2 serveurs : A et B.
Le serveur A contient une version de production d'une base de donn=E9es
SQL Server 2008, et le B contient une base de d=E9veloppement. Nous
souhaitons mettre en place une r=E9plication de ces bases de la fa=E7on
suivante :
- la base de production de A sera r=E9pliqu=E9e sur B,
- la base de d=E9veloppement de B sera r=E9pliqu=E9e sur A
Le but =E9tant d'avoir toujours un serveur en ligne pour la production
et le d=E9veloppement en cas de d=E9faillance de l'un ou l'autre.
Je comptais mettre en place un syst=E8me de r=E9plication
transactionnelle, mais n'ayant jamais effectu=E9 cette manipulation, je
ne suis pas certain que ce soit la meilleure fa=E7on de faire.
Pourriez vous m'indiquer les avantages et inconv=E9nients de cette
m=E9thode, et =E9ventuellement une meilleure fa=E7on de faire ?
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Serguei Tarassov
On 15/06/2010 09:50, Xavier wrote:
Nous avons actuellement 2 serveurs : A et B.
Le serveur A contient une version de production d'une base de données SQL Server 2008, et le B contient une base de développement. Nous souhaitons mettre en place une réplication de ces bases de la façon suivante :
- la base de production de A sera répliquée sur B, - la base de développement de B sera répliquée sur A
Le but étant d'avoir toujours un serveur en ligne pour la production et le développement en cas de défaillance de l'un ou l'autre.
Je comptais mettre en place un système de réplication transactionnelle, mais n'ayant jamais effectué cette manipulation, je ne suis pas certain que ce soit la meilleure façon de faire.
Pourriez vous m'indiquer les avantages et inconvénients de cette méthode, et éventuellement une meilleure façon de faire ?
Bonjour,
Je ne vois pas d'intérêt à utiliser la réplication dans ce cas.
Vous pouvez mettre en place la configuration à haute disponibilité comme "copie des journaux de transaction" ou "mise en miroir de bases de données".
Dans ce cas il est possible héberger le BDD de développement dans un des vos serveurs mais je n'en recommande pas.
A+ Serguei TARASSOV MCITP SQL Server Dev/DBA http://sgbd.arbinada.com
On 15/06/2010 09:50, Xavier wrote:
Nous avons actuellement 2 serveurs : A et B.
Le serveur A contient une version de production d'une base de données
SQL Server 2008, et le B contient une base de développement. Nous
souhaitons mettre en place une réplication de ces bases de la façon
suivante :
- la base de production de A sera répliquée sur B,
- la base de développement de B sera répliquée sur A
Le but étant d'avoir toujours un serveur en ligne pour la production
et le développement en cas de défaillance de l'un ou l'autre.
Je comptais mettre en place un système de réplication
transactionnelle, mais n'ayant jamais effectué cette manipulation, je
ne suis pas certain que ce soit la meilleure façon de faire.
Pourriez vous m'indiquer les avantages et inconvénients de cette
méthode, et éventuellement une meilleure façon de faire ?
Bonjour,
Je ne vois pas d'intérêt à utiliser la réplication dans ce cas.
Vous pouvez mettre en place la configuration à haute disponibilité comme
"copie des journaux de transaction" ou "mise en miroir de bases de données".
Dans ce cas il est possible héberger le BDD de développement dans un des
vos serveurs mais je n'en recommande pas.
A+
Serguei TARASSOV
MCITP SQL Server Dev/DBA
http://sgbd.arbinada.com
Le serveur A contient une version de production d'une base de données SQL Server 2008, et le B contient une base de développement. Nous souhaitons mettre en place une réplication de ces bases de la façon suivante :
- la base de production de A sera répliquée sur B, - la base de développement de B sera répliquée sur A
Le but étant d'avoir toujours un serveur en ligne pour la production et le développement en cas de défaillance de l'un ou l'autre.
Je comptais mettre en place un système de réplication transactionnelle, mais n'ayant jamais effectué cette manipulation, je ne suis pas certain que ce soit la meilleure façon de faire.
Pourriez vous m'indiquer les avantages et inconvénients de cette méthode, et éventuellement une meilleure façon de faire ?
Bonjour,
Je ne vois pas d'intérêt à utiliser la réplication dans ce cas.
Vous pouvez mettre en place la configuration à haute disponibilité comme "copie des journaux de transaction" ou "mise en miroir de bases de données".
Dans ce cas il est possible héberger le BDD de développement dans un des vos serveurs mais je n'en recommande pas.
A+ Serguei TARASSOV MCITP SQL Server Dev/DBA http://sgbd.arbinada.com